Hi there,

Ok there are a number of things you can try and i will try to name a few
here.

* Make sure that you don't have the registry hacks applied as per our
FAQ as they will make your game lag out.
* Update your network card drivers as we have had a few users who had
problems until they did an upgrade.
* Try a different socks prog (eg if you used freecap try sockscap and
vice versa)
* Try a different server as you ISP might be having routing issues to
the server you are using.

If all of the above fails please try the below as your line could be
having some noise/fault and the connection could be timing out.

You see what happens when you are using Gamemax your connection is
boosted somewhat and the fault tolerance drops, so when normally your
game would just freeze(packet loss) and after some time everything would
unfreeze and run in 'fast' mode for a few sec's, thats packet loss and
you had a interruption in connection. Now when the same happens when
connecting via Gamemax if there is no response for a while your putty
could cut the connection and treat it as a timeout. This would be
especially noticeable on wireless connections as packet loss is a lot
more common (read through the FAQ when you get a chance ).

There is no setting in putty to increase the 'dead connection' timeout
but there is a windows setting that could help. There are actually 3 of
them you can try and more details about all of them are in the links below.

Here is a link to the putty FAQ, take note of point 7.10 and 7.11.
http://www.chiark.greenend.org.uk/~sgtatham/putty/faq.html#faq-idleout

Here are instructions on how to add the reg key.
http://www.neophob.com/serendipity/index.php?/archives/92-Putty-SSH-Timeouts.html


And microsoft knowledge base details on the registry key. Please take
note of the 'TcpMaxConnectRetransmissions' and
'TcpMaxDataRetransmissions' descriptions.
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;en-us;314053

We truly hope that helps so please let us know.

Best Regards
GameMax Team

Any Gamemax person here to give some insight into why this service is not raid-friendly?
 
From what I understand, they limit the bandwidth each connection uses in order to share it out.
Unfortunately this has the downside of disconnecting you whenever you get spikes of information, AoE being a prime example.
You might possibly be able to get around this by disabling any mods that share info and your combatlog but personally I'd rather just raid without it.
